A bull flag pattern is a chart pattern that occurs when a stock is in a strong uptrend. It is called a flag pattern because when you see it on a chart it looks like a flag on a pole and since we are in an uptrend it is considered a bullish flag.

When should you trade a flag pattern?
A flag chart pattern is formed when the market consolidates in a narrow range after a sharp move. The flag portion of the pattern must run between parallel lines and can either be slanted up, down, or even sideways. Enter a trade when the prices break above or below the upper or lower trendline of the flag
